Understanding Licensing and Regulation in Online Casinos
The world of online casinos can seem opaque, making it vital to understand the role of licensing and regulation. Different jurisdictions offer varying levels of oversight, significantly impacting the fairness and security of online gaming experiences. Some of the most respected regulatory bodies include the United Kingdom Gambling Commission (UKGC), the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A), and the Gibraltar Regulatory Authority. These organizations impose strict standards on operators, covering aspects like game fairness, responsible gambling measures, and data protection. A casino holding a license from a reputable authority provides a strong indication of its commitment to ethical operation and player safety. It's essential to verify the license information directly on the casino’s website, often found in the footer, and ideally, cross-reference it with the licensing authority's official records.
The Importance of Independent Audits
Beyond licensing, independent audits play a crucial role in verifying the integrity of online casino games. Companies like eCOGRA (e-Commerce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ance) and iTech Labs conduct thorough testing of Random Number Generators (RNGs) and payout percentages. RNGs are the algorithms that determine the outcomes of casino games, and their fairness is paramount. Independent audits ensure that these algorithms are truly random and haven’t been manipulated to favor the casino. Regular audits also assess the casino’s compliance with industry standards and provide transparency for players. These audits add an extra layer of security and trust, demonstrating the casino’s commitment to fair play. Look for casinos that prominently display the logos of these auditing organizations on their websites.
| Regulatory Body | Jurisdiction | Key Responsibilities |
|---|---|---|
| U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) | United Kingdom | Licensing, regulation, and enforcement of gambling laws in Great Britain. |
|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) | Malta | Issuing and regulating gaming licenses, ensuring a safe and responsible gaming environment. |
| Gibraltar Regulatory Authority | Gibraltar | Licensing and regulating gambling operators, protecting consumers and preventing crime. |
The presence of a legitimate license and regularly published audit reports should be a primary consideration for any prospective online casino player. It’s a clear sign the platform takes player protection seriously.
Exploring Secure Payment Options
Once you've identified a licensed and trustworthy online casino, the next critical step is ensuring secure and reliable payment options. A wide range of methods should be available, catering to different preferences and security needs. Commonly accepted methods include credit and debit cards (Visa, Mastercard), e-wallets (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ller), bank transfers, and increasingly, cryptocurrencies. Each method carries different levels of security and transaction fees. Credit and debit cards offer fraud protection through your bank, while e-wallets provide an extra layer of security by masking your bank account details from the casino. Bank transfers can be secure but may involve longer processing times. Cryptocurrencies, like Bitcoin, offer anonymity and fast transactions but can be volatile in value.
The Role of SSL Encryption and Two-Factor Authentication
Regardless of the payment method chosen, it’s essential that the casino utilizes robust security measures to protect your financial information. Look for casinos that employ SSL (Secure Socket Layer) encryption, indicated by "https://" in the website’s address bar and a padlock icon. SSL encryption safeguards data transmitted between your computer and the casino’s servers, preventing interception by malicious actors. Furthermore, en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) adds an extra layer of protection to your account. 2FA requires a secondary verification code, typically sent to your mobile phone, in addition to your password, making it significantly more difficult for unauthorized users to access your account, even if they obtain your password.
- Credit/Debit Cards: Widely accepted, offer fraud protection.
- E-Wallets (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ller): Enhanced security, faster withdrawals.
- Bank Transfers: Secure but may have longer processing times.
- Cryptocurrencies: Anonymity, fast transactions, potential volatility.
Prioritizing casinos that demonstrate a strong commitment to security through encryption and 2FA is paramount for protecting your funds and personal information.
Understanding Bonus Terms and Conditions
Online casinos frequently offer bonuses and promotions to attract new players and retain existing ones. These can range from welcome bonuses and free spins to deposit matches and loyalty programs. While bonuses can be enticing, it’s crucial to understand the associated terms and conditions before accepting them. Often, bonuses come with wagering requirements, which specify the amount you need to bet before you can withdraw any winnings generated from the bonus funds. These wagering requirements can vary significantly between casinos and bonuses. Other terms to look out for include game restrictions, maximum bet limits, and expiration dates. Failing to meet these conditions can result in the forfeiture of your bonus funds and any associated winnings.
The Importance of Responsible Gambling and Setting Limits
Gambling should always be viewed as a form of entertainment, and it’s essential to approach it responsibly. Setting limits on your deposits, wagers, and playing time is a crucial part of responsible gambling. Many online casinos offer tools to help you manage your gambling habits, such as deposit limits, loss limits, and self-exclusion options. Deposit limits restrict the amount of money you can deposit into your account over a specific period, while loss limits cap the amount you can lose. Self-exclusion allows you to temporarily or permanently block yourself from accessing the casino. If you feel like your gambling is becoming problematic, resources like GamCare and GambleAware offer support and assistance.
- Set a budget and stick to it.
- Only gamble with money you can afford to lose.
- Take frequent breaks.
- Don’t chase your losses.
- Utilize responsible gambling tools offered by the casino.

Navigating Mobile Casino Gaming and App Security
The proliferation of smartphones and tablets has led to a surge in mobile casino gaming. Most online casinos now offer fully optimized mobile websites or dedicated mobile apps that allow players to access their favorite games on the go. While convenient, mobile gaming introduces unique security considerations. It’s crucial to only download apps from official app stores (Apple App Store or Google Play Store) to minimize the risk of downloading malware or fake casino apps. Ensure the app requires a strong password and offers two-factor authentication. Also, be cautious when using public Wi-Fi networks, as they can be vulnerable to hacking. Consider using a Virtual Private Network (VPN) to encrypt your internet connection and protect your data, especially when accessing sensitive information like your financial details. Regularly update both your operating system and the casino app to benefit from the latest security patches and bug fixes.
Mobile gaming offers unparalleled convenience, but vigilance regarding app security and network connections is essential to ensure a safe and enjoyable experience. Staying informed about best practices and utilizing available security tools will help mitigate potential risks.
